Short journey by private plane to cover the hotspots of Madagascar. This is one of the most efficient ways to visit Madagascar and enjoy its highlights within a short time frame.
The sites visited in this tour program are primarily selected for their unique biodiversity and scenic features.
Due to the state of the roads in Madagascar, these places could be reached quite easily by plane. This is why we use private flights on this tour program: to allow you to enjoy your holiday at a leisurely pace.
Departing from Antananarivo, you will be flying over the Tsingy rock forest and the Baobab Avenue in Morondava. Right after, you will explore on 4WD the Baobab Avenue and the Kirindy Reserve on the West coast.
Getting inland, you will reach Ranomafana National Park by landing in Fianarantsoa, the closest airport. Continuing by a short overland trip on a paved road, you will be visiting the Reserve of Anja – known for its Ring-tailed lemurs – the iconic animal of the wildlife of Madagascar.
Then you will fly down south to Tulear to reach the lagoon of Ifaty – known for its Baobabs and spiny forest. You will then head eastwards and will land in the bush of Berenty to meet the dancing lemurs, amongst other typical animals.
After such active exploration, some lazy days at Manafiafy Bay inside an exclusive estate would be quite rewarding.
You will take the regular flight from Fort Dauphin to Antananarivo and will head eastwards for an overland trip to Andasibe National Park. This park is one of Madagascar’s most famous reserves, home to the flagship species, the Indri Indri, among other wildlife.
This is a short trip, but it will make your Madagascar vacation the most of Madagascar’s nature and wildlife, as this luxury tour covers a major part of the island’s authentic sites.
